Abstract

Players increasingly adopt a data-driven approach to review and improve their gaming skills. In the wake of this, spatio-temporal visualizations gained popularity but remain challenging to design. Storyline visualizations are unique in the way they integrate time and location information into a single view to show how entity relationships develop over time. We adopt the storyline visualization technique to summarize gameplay for the purpose of post-play review. We demonstrate the method by applying it to League of Legends matches and evaluated it with 39 players of the game in a task-based online study using the triad framework for spatio-temporal queries by Peuquet. Results indicate that players responded positively to the approach and could, by and large, solve tasks well but that time-based tasks proved most challenging and least efficient to solve. Based on our findings, we reflect on possibilities for enhancing the design of storyline visualizations for game-related data analysis.
